Your rights under the GDPR

According to the GDPR, you have the following rights, which you can assert with us at any time:

The right to obtain information: According to Art. 15 GDPR, you can request confirmation of whether and which personal data we process from you. In addition, you can request free of charge information about the processing purposes, the category of personal data, the categories of recipients to whom your data has been disclosed or the planned storage period, the right of rectification, deletion, limitation of processing or opposition, the existence of a right of appeal and the origin of the data, if it was not collected by us. You also have the right to know whether your personal data has been transmitted to a third country or to an international organisation. If so, you have the right to obtain information about the appropriate guarantees in connection with the transfer.

The right to demand correction: Pursuant to Art. 16 GDPR, you may request to correct or complete the personal data relating to you and stored in our possession.

The right to demand deletion: According to Art. 17 DSGVO you have the right to demand the deletion of your personal data stored by us, as far as we do not need it for the following purposes:

  • to fulfill a legal obligation,
  • to assert, exercise or defend legal claims,
  • to exercise the right of free expression and information or
  • for the purposes of public interest referred to in Article 17 (3) (c) and (d) of the GDPR.

The right to demand restriction: According to Art. 18 GDPR you have the right to demand the restriction of the processing of your personal data, if:

  • The accuracy of the data is disputed by you, for a period of time that allows us to verify the accuracy of your personal information,
  • the processing of your data is unlawful, but you reject its deletion and instead demand the restriction of the use of the data,
  • I no longer need your personal information for processing purposes, but you need it to assert, exercise or defend your rights,
  • You have lodged an objection against the processing of your data in accordance with Art. 21 GDPR, but it is not yet certain whether the legitimate reasons that justified us despite your objection to further processing outweigh your rights.

The right to demand disclosure: If you have asserted the right of rectification, deletion or restriction of your personal data processed by us, we are obliged to inform all recipients to whom the personal data concerning you has been made available about the correction or deletion or the limitation of the processing of the data requested by you unless this proves impossible or involves disproportionate effort. You have the right to be informed by us about these recipients.

The right to demand data portability: Pursuant to Art. 20 GDPR, you may request that we provide you with the personal data you have provided to us in a structured, standard and machine-readable format, or request that we send it to another person in charge.

The right of appeal: According to Art. 77 GDPR you have the right to complain to a supervisory authority. For this you can contact the supervisory authority of your usual place of residence, your job or your residence.
